How Ronke Fawole, The Brain Behind Jaderon Aso Oke Makes Lagos Royalties, Celebs Look Regal

Mrs Aderonke Oluwatoyin Fawole, is the creative mind behind Jaderon Aso Oke located on Lagos Island. She is arguably the new, most-sought after brand among rich Yoruba Obas, society bigwigs and celebrities. For a couple of years now, she has been the stylist of Oba Saheed Ademola Elegushi, (the Onikate of Ikate-Elegushi) and his wife. She is the creator of the monarch's breath-taking, royal attires. Jaderon is behind most of the elegant styles rocked by the wife of the monarch, Queen Aramide Sekinat who is a trends-setter for many other Queens when it comes to fashion and style. She offers same services to other prominent Yoruba traditional rulers and high-profile people, including the new Oniru of Iruland, Oba Gbolahan Lawal and his wife Queen Mariam, the Oba of Epe, Lagos Head of Service, Hakeem Muri Okunola.
Aso Oke, the popular yoruba traditional, hand-made fabric has never gone out of fashion. It's been there for centuries. And year in, year out; weavers have been introducing new, fashionable patterns and designs (of Aso Oke) in tune with latest trends.
Aso Oke has become so relevant, remaining the choice of Yoruba leaders, elites and other socially-inclined personality who make different designs and styles with it.

In Yoruba land, Aso Oke is the official attire of the royal fathers. Their fashionable wives also have different styles of rocking the traditional Yoruba fabric, to the extent that women from other tribes have fallen in love with it.
This trend makes it obvious that Aso Oke has come to stay. That is why today, you see different designs of beautifully-crafted aso oke at weddings, burials, naming and more. In Lagos, there are different designers with big names in the aso oke business. And Ronke Fawole ranks high among them.

For Aderonke, dealing Aso Oke is a family business. She took over from her mother, who interestingly, also took over from her mum (Aderonke's grandmother). So, that makes it three generations in the business.

Ronke graduated from Olabisi Onabanjo University, where she studied Industrial and Labour Relations. She joined her mother in the business immediately after.
